Summary:An apparatus for detecting multiple objects using adaptive block partitioning is disclosed. An object contour extracting unit configured to extract a contour information of an object using a local binary pattern LBP and difference image between adjacent images. An adaptive block partitioning unit configured to perform a block partitioning of an object not overlapped based on the extracted contour information. A motion quantization unit configured to calculate a motion orientation histogram MOH of the object by performing N-directional quantization about a motion vector. An object detection unit configured to detect the object using a block of the partitioned object, the contour information and the MOH, and estimate a moving direction of the object after performing labeling the detected object. The apparatus may process effectively data through eight-directional quantization of a motion vector of an object using motion information provided in advance from an ISP chip, detect proper area of the object in the unit of a block with minimizing motion error of the object through the block with adaptive size and orientation histogram, and estimate simultaneously moving direction of the object with the detection of the object.
